A colourfully-illustrated and informative – and readable - children’s encyclopaedia
This 160-page book is a colourfully-illustrated and informative volume that looks at the wide range of dinosaurs that once inhabited our planet.It is well-illustrated with photographs, diagrams, maps and other illustrations - mainly photo-realistic artwork. It is extremely informative and easy to read. It is intended for younger readers, but older ones (and adults) will also find it interesting and informative. It covers quite a wide range of subjects, as well as individual dinosaur types, and will serve very well an encyclopaedia for children.It is divided into chapters, with a series of two-page sections within each chapter illustrating a particular group of creatures, with a couple of chapters on the wider world of the dinosaurs.The Contents are -P009: The First DinosaursP033: A World of DinosaursP065: The Time of the GiantsP097: A Flowering WorldP129: Change & ExtinctionP155: Glossary & Index
